In episode 8 of the Hitting The Areas Podcast, Richard and Jamie speak with San Marino Academy star Millie Chandarana. At 24 years of age, Millie has already had a fascinating journey in football. Millie tells us about how she got into football, starting in a boys team and finally moving to a girls team to one of the biggest clubs in the world in Manchester United. Millie chats to the boys about her days at Loughborough University which led to a move abroad to start her professional career which has now ended up in Serie A in Italy.
This is a fascinating insight into the drive and determination that Millie has to succeed at the very top level of the game and to be doing it in an unfamiliar country. The Manchester born 24 year old tells the boys about living in Italy, the San Marino Academy, the Italian way of playing, that goal against Juventus plus her future ambitions.
